架设传奇手游需完成需求分析、技术选型、环境搭建、部署测试、运营推广五大核心环节。从基础服务器配置到用户交互功能开发,每个步骤均需兼顾稳定性与可扩展性。本文通过全流程拆解,提供从零到一搭建完整系统的实用指南。
一、明确搭建需求与目标定位
用户群体画像:需区分核心玩家(PK/社交需求)与休闲玩家(挂机/养成需求)
玩法模块规划:确定经典PK玩法、装备系统、社交功能等基础架构
资源预算分配:服务器成本(初期建议3-5台云服务器)、开发人力(UI/程序/测试)
合规性审查:获取版号前需完成防沉迷系统对接与内容审核备案
二、选择合适的技术架构与开发工具
服务器架构:采用微服务架构(Nginx+Spring Cloud),支持分布式部署
开发框架:使用Unity3D+MySQL组合,兼顾图形渲染与数据处理效率
数据库选型:Redis缓存热点数据,MySQL集群处理事务型数据
安全防护:部署WAF防火墙,设置IP限流与SQL注入防护规则
三、搭建基础环境与系统配置
服务器部署:购买AWS/Aliyun云服务器(推荐4核8G配置)
数据库安装:配置MySQL 8.0集群,设置主从复制与自动备份
框架集成:通过Docker容器化部署开发环境,配置CI/CD流水线
网络优化:启用CDN加速静态资源,设置服务器负载均衡策略
四、核心功能开发与测试验证
角色系统开发:实现等级成长曲线与装备继承算法
PK对战系统:编写实时战斗逻辑与积分结算模块
社交功能实现:开发组队/公会/聊天室基础功能
测试验证:进行万人同时在线压力测试,优化数据库查询效率
五、运营推广与持续优化
渠道接入:对接第三方登录平台(微信/QQ/手机号)
活动策划:设计新手引导、限时活动、排行榜奖励机制
数据监控:部署APM系统实时监测服务器响应时间
迭代升级:每季度推出新版本,保持玩法新鲜度
传奇手游搭建需遵循"架构先行、功能迭代、安全护航"原则。初期应重点保障服务器承载能力与核心玩法体验,中期通过数据驱动优化运营策略,后期建立版本更新与用户反馈的闭环机制。建议采用模块化开发模式,预留接口支持后续功能扩展,同时建立自动化运维体系降低管理成本。
【常见问题解答】
Q1:传奇手游搭建需要多少服务器资源?
A:初期建议3台云服务器(1主2备),支持5000人同时在线
Q2:如何保证游戏数据安全性?
A:部署异地多活数据库+区块链存证,设置双重加密传输
Q3:版号申请需要哪些材料?
A:需提供完整游戏源代码、内容审核报告、防沉迷系统证明
Q4:开发周期大概需要多久?
A:基础版本3个月完成,包含核心PK玩法与社交系统
Q5:如何控制开发成本?
A:采用开源框架+外包开发模式,初期预算控制在20-30万
Q6:新手引导设计要点?
A:设置7日成长任务+实时NPC指导,转化率需达85%以上
Q7:服务器运维成本占比?
A:建议控制在总营收的15%-20%,采用弹性伸缩方案
Q8:如何提升用户留存率?
A:设计7日留存奖励+赛季制更新,配合每日活跃任务体系